What is the area of a circle with a diameter of 15.8 cm? Use 3.14 for pi and round your final answer to the nearest hundredth. Enter your answer in the box.

Step-by-step explanation:

Area of a circle is given by

A = pi r^2

We are given the diameter.  We need to find the radius

d= 2r

15.8 = 2r

Divide by 2

7.9 =r

Now we can find the area

A = pi * (7.9)^2

A = pi *62.41

Let pi = 3.14

A = (3.14) * 62.41

   = 195.9674 cm^2

We round to the nearest hundredths

A=195.97 cm^2
